Directions

  1. In a frying pan heat olive oil.
  2. Put in a pinch of rosemary and saute until the scent gets very pungent.
  3. Add broccoli and a couple of dashes of white pepper (2-4).
  4. Saute until the broccoli gets very green but looks crunchy/cooked.
  5. Lastly, toss in bread crumbs a bit at a time while still sauteing.
  6. The crumbs will start to stick into the broccoli.
  7. Once all or most of the crumbs are in the broccoli, saute for 1 or 2 minutes longer to brown.
  8. Serve right away.
